Price analysis: Baile Corcigh averages $9.87 per item while Fergie's averages $6.51, making Fergie's approximately $3.36 cheaper per item on average.

Menu Item Price Comparison

1 items

Shared menu items ranked by largest price difference between Baile Corcigh and Fergie's

# Menu Item Baile Corcigh Fergie's Price Gap
1 Shepherd's Pie $14.50 $10.00 $4.50
